Running angling trips out of Loreto, Rubio Sportfishing invites you to check out the local fishery in style, on one of their super panga boats.
Capt. Alfredo is here to get you on some fish, and to make sure you have fun doing it. You'll be using techniques like bottom fishing, trolling, or jigging, depending on what you're going after. As part of their 7-hour trips, you can target species like Mahi Mahi, Sailfish, Marlin, and Snapper, depending on the current season and weather conditions.
You'll be fishing from a 25' Honda boat with enough room for up to 4 anglers at any single time.
When it comes to rods, reels, and terminal tackle, everything you need is included in the price.
No need to worry about fishing licenses, as they will be provided and handled by the charter.
You can keep anything you catch, as long as it's legal to do so.
You'll find free snacks, drinks, and lunch on the boat for your convenience, but you're always welcome to pack your own drinks and snacks should you want to.
Up for a family trip? This is a children-friendly business, so bring your loved ones to share these memories with.

What a great experience! Rubio sport fishing did not disappoint. The communication was timely and our captain, Jesus, worked really hard to put us on some fish. The week that we were there was slow for everyone, considering it was Dorado season. Jesus kept switching things up and stayed on the radio when necessary to ensure that we were able to get what we came for. Overall, we caught 7, three Dorado that yielded two keepers! The fish were vacuum, sealed, and delivered to us on the dock within 30 minutes. We couldn’t have asked for a better day and experience! I highly recommend Rubio Sport Fishing and cant wait to go back!

We booked multiple days with Rubio sportfishing. Alfredo Rubio and our captain Carlos were great. Carlos listened to our gameplan/feedback of what fish we wanted to target and put us on the fish accordingly. We got loads of yellowtail, cabrilla and a few other unexpected catches: cubera snapper, sierra, jack crevalle. We also had them vacuum seal and freeze some of the catch so we could take it home. When we go back to loreto, we will certainly be booking with them again.

Capt. Alfredo Rubio Quintana first fished at Loreto with his father on an 18' wooden boat with a 6 HP engine, using nets. That was 25 years ago when Capt. Alfredo was 12 years old. Their next Loreto fishing boat was a 20' fiberglass boat, a narrow boat with a 25 HP Johnson engine. When the captain was 17, they bought their first 'speed boat.' It was a 22' La Paz-style skiff with a 55 HP motor. In this boat, his father and he would lead as fishing guides for private boats visiting the Club de Vuelo. At 24, Captain Alfredo began working on his own fishing boat. His dad continues the same work, as does one brother. The three of them now have 4 Super Pangas. Nowadays, Captain Alfredo has a kind of enterprise with his sons with 4 Super Pangas ('Alicia 1', 'Alicia 2', 'Alicia 3', and 'Aleisamar') and 1 boat ('Kaiser').
